Plasma behavior in the scrapeoff and divertor regions of the single-null configuration of the International Tokamak Reactor (INTOR) has been predicted by means of a one-dimensional model of transport through the plasma sheath at the divertor target.

The effect of varying the diameter of a polystyrene disk on the value of its dielectric constant when measured in a resonator of fixed diameter is investigated. Agreement is obtained with results predicted by perturbation theory.
